Genetic Factors

Genetic predisposition plays a crucial role in developing alcohol use disorders. Studies indicate that genetics account for approximately 50% of the risk for addiction. Family history of alcoholism increases susceptibility, as specific genes influence how individuals metabolize alcohol and experience its effects. Identifying these genetic factors is essential for tailoring rehabilitation approaches that address individual needs.

Environmental Factors

Environmental influences significantly impact alcohol consumption patterns. Factors include social environment, peer pressure, and accessibility to alcohol. In Baggs, cultural attitudes toward drinking and the availability of alcohol may contribute to higher rates of abuse. Stressors such as work-related pressures or personal issues can also escalate alcohol use as a coping mechanism. Addressing these environmental aspects is vital for crafting holistic treatment plans.

Physical Health Consequences

Alcohol abuse can lead to severe physical health issues. Chronic consumption increases the risk of liver diseases, including cirrhosis and fatty liver. Cardiovascular problems, such as hypertension and cardiomyopathy, can also arise due to excessive drinking. Furthermore, chronic alcohol abuse is linked to various cancers, including breast and liver cancer.

Mental Health Consequences

Alcohol abuse adversely affects mental health. Individuals may experience increased anxiety, depression, and mood disorders. Excessive alcohol consumption alters brain chemistry, leading to cognitive impairments and decision-making difficulties. This cycle often perpetuates a reliance on alcohol as a coping mechanism, exacerbating mental health issues.

Support Groups

Support groups facilitate shared experiences and mutual encouragement among individuals dealing with alcohol addiction. Groups like Alcoholics Anonymous (AA) offer a safe space for individuals to share their journeys and gain insights from others. Meetings typically occur weekly in accessible locations, creating a community of peers who understand the struggles of addiction.
